Biography

A well-rounded Human Resources Professional with 25+ years of both Local and International experience, in leading multinational companies including British American Tobacco Plc (BAT), Royal Dutch Shell, General Electric Company (GE), and in a leading regional brand, National Social Security Fund Uganda.

Milton is currently Chief People & Culture Officer at the National Social Security Fund. He has previously held several senior HR leadership positions, including HR Director BAT Eastern and Southern Africa, before moving on to become HR Director for BAT West and Central Africa. He joined Royal Dutch Shell Plc as HR Director for Anglophone Africa, with HR responsibility for all the English-speaking countries in Africa. After 7 years with Shell, he joined General Electric Company (GE) where he was HR Director Africa.

Milton has worked in several countries across Africa, in Europe, and the US over the years. Well experienced in stewarding Strategic Human Resource Leadership and Business Partnership at Board level, and in multi country structures.

He is passionate about Talent optimization, Leading Organizational Change, Driving a High-Performance Culture and Executive Coaching.

Holds an MBA in Strategic Human Resource Management (University of Leicester, UK), Certificate in Global Business Leadership (INSEAD Business School, France) and a bachelor’s degree in economics and public administration (Makerere University).

Milton is an Advanced Professional Coach and a member of the International Coaching Federation (ICF). He is also a member of League of East Africa Directors, LEAD.
